One of the key factors to consider when choosing gate hinges for heavy gates is the material. These hinges need to withstand significant weight and pressure, so they are typically made from durable materials like steel, stainless steel, or wrought iron. The strength of these materials ensures that the gate hinges for heavy gates will provide reliable performance even in harsh weather conditions. Stainless steel is particularly popular due to its corrosion resistance, making it ideal for outdoor use in areas with high humidity or exposure to rain.

In addition to strength and size, the type of hinge also matters. There are various types of gate hinges for heavy gates, such as continuous, butt, and strap hinges. Strap hinges are often preferred for larger gates because they distribute the weight evenly along the length of the gate, reducing stress on the pivot point. Continuous hinges, on the other hand, provide extra support across the entire gate frame, making them ideal for gates that are subject to frequent use. Choosing the right type of hinge is key to ensuring that the gate operates smoothly and remains secure.
